98-Mar-B5 May 2016 Page 2 of 22 SECTION A CALCULATIVE QUESTIONS Show all steps in the calculations and state the units for all intermediate and final answers. QUESTION 1 PUMP POWER AND EFFICIENCY PARTI PUMP POWER REQUIREMENT 100 mm V, 2 1.5 m The diameters of the suction and discharge pipes of a pump are 150 mm and 100 mm, respectively. The discharge pressure is read by a gauge at a point 1.5 m above the centre line of the pump. and the suction pressure is read by a gauge 0.5 m I below the centre line. The pressure gauge reads a pressure of 150 of 150 kPa kPa and the suction gauge reads a vacuum of 30 kPa (negative gauge pressure) when gasoline having a specific gravity of 0.75 is pumped at the rate of 0.035 m/s. Calculate the electrical power required to pump the fluid if the pump efficiency is 75%. (5 marks) + 0.5 m 150 mm V, PART II HOMOLOGOUS PUMP SCALING A one tenth (1/10) scale model pump impeller with a diameter of 188 mm is tested in a test facility using water under the following conditions: Pump Speed Head Flow 3600 rev/min 39.6 m 0.085 m/s Under these conditions the model impeller was found to have an efficiency of 84%. A homologous prototype (with an impeller 10 times the diameter of the model and geometrically identical to it) is to be installed and operated under a head of 110 m while pumping water. Determine the following: (a) Speed at which the prototype pump would need to operate to ensure homologous conditions. (b) Flow rate of water through the pump under homologous conditions. (C) Power required to operate the pump assuming ideal conditions. (d) Efficiency anticipated under the above conditions. (5 marks) (10 marks)
